Non-contact
Our reliable and precise non-contact measurement devices are quick and easy to set up, with multiple outputs available.
Checking thickness of aluminium cans
Orbit® LTH is being used to check the aluminium sheet thickness as it comes off the roll.
LTH measuring shaft run out
The high-end laser from Solartron metrology has the capability to 'scan', enabling measurements whilst moving, which is useful in applications such as testing the smoothness of cylindrical objects.
Checking the thickness of a piece part
Two lasers can be used to simultaneously check the thickness of a piece part. This is particularly useful for use on delicate and moving material.
Checking the components of a HDD
With a small spot size, Solartron's laser triangulation units are perfect for taking measurements of small holes and gaps.
Checking the depth of a tyre tread
With up to 40 khz sampling speed, the LTH can determine the depth of tyre tread post-production.
Checking the roundness of a motor shaft
With a high sampling rate and the ability to scan read, the LTH is ideal for measuring the roundness of thin parts, such as a motor shaft.
Checking the height of a fly wheel
With either 2 or 10 mm measurement ranges, height can be determined quickly and easily.
Our reliable and precise non-contact measurement devices are quick and easy to set up, with multiple outputs available into a PC or PLC. Non-contact sensors are used to meet the needs of manufacturers of sterile or delicate products as well as items that might be scratched by traditional touch probes.
